Function
Detector output. Active low when indicating
loop or ring-trip detection, active high when
indicating ground key detection.
+5 V power supply.
Programmable loop detector threshold. The
loop detection threshold os programmed by a
resistor connected from this pin to AGND.
Programmable overhead voltage. If pin is left
open: The overhead voltage is internally set
to min 2.7 V in off- hook and min 1.1 V in on-
hook. If a resistor is connected between this
pin and AGND: The overhead voltage can be
set to higher values.
Programmable line current, the constant
current part of the DC feed characteristic is
programmed by a resistor connected from
this pin to AGND.
A reference, 49.9 k , resistor should be
connected from this pin to AGND.
Receive summing node. 200 times the AC
current flowing into this pin equals the
metallic (transversal) AC current flowing from
RINGX to TIPX. Programming networks for
two-wire impedance and receive gain
connect to the receive node. A resistor should
be connected from this pin to AGND.
Analog ground, should be tied together with
BGND.
